#6e4826 - Pickled Bean color
This deep, earthy brown carries warm reddish undertones, evoking polished walnut and toasted chestnut. It reads as a medium-dark, slightly muted brown with a cozy, vintage character—like worn leather upholstery or autumn bark warmed by late afternoon light. It feels grounding and rustic, adding depth without harshness. Works well in interiors, branding, and fashion when paired with olive greens, muted golds, cream, or slate blue, lending a timeless, autumnal elegance to palettes and materials.
#6e4826 color RGB value is 110, 72, 38, and the CMYK value is 0.00, 0.345, 0.655, 0.569. Alternative names for that color are: pickled bean, gray, saddlebrown, sepia, orange.
